Book excerpt: La santé bucco-dentaire est une dimension essentielle de la santé générale et de la qualité de vie. L'amélioration significative et durable de l'hygiène orale est un des piliers de la prévention et des soins bucco-dentaires. De nombreuses stratégies ont été testées pour induire et/ou soutenir des changements de comportement positifs en matière d'hygiène bucco-dentaire avec des résultats variables. L'utilisation des appareils mobiles et autres supports connectés connait une croissance exponentielle en santé (mSanté) et, depuis quelques années, dans le domaine bucco-dentaire mais l'intérêt de cette approche dans ce contexte n'est pas clairement établi. L'essentiel de ce manuscrit est consacré à une revue systématique de la littérature, qui examine l'efficacité de la mSanté pour améliorer l'hygiène orale, en particulier dans un contexte parodontal. Neuf essais contrôlés randomisés ont été sélectionnés parmi 1729 références. Six études sur neuf (67% tous types d'interventions confondues) indiquent un effet positif de la mSanté sur l'amélioration des scores de plaque et d'inflammation gingivale (4 études). En conclusion, Les stratégies de mSanté semblent efficaces pour améliorer à court terme le contrôle de plaque individuel et, dans une moindre mesure, la santé gingivale, lorsqu'elles sont utilisées en complément de l'OHI/OHM conventionnelle, en particulier chez des adolescents suivis en orthodontie. La supériorité d'une stratégie par rapport à une autre n'a pas pu être établie. Ces résultats sont encourageants mais encore insuffisants pour justifier la généralisation de ce type d'intervention en pratique clinique. Faute de données, aucune conclusion ne peut être tirée concernant le bénéfice de la mSanté chez des patients atteints de gingivite ou de parodontite.

Book excerpt: Les pratiques d'hygiène bucco-dentaire dans les établissements accueillant des personnes en situation de handicap ou dépendantes sont très nettement insuffisantes, ce qui participe à augmenter le risque des pathologies bucco-dentaires de nature infectieuse et de leurs comorbidités pour la population qu'ils accueillent. Le projet Santé Orale et Autonomie (SOA) est une mesure développée dans le cadre du plan national de Prévention bucco-dentaire 2006-2009 qui visait à rémunérer des chirurgiens-dentistes, pour qu'ils mettent en place, après une formation en ligne, une action de promotion de la santé orale dans un de ces établissements, selon un protocole commun standardisé qui comportait : 1) une conférence de sensibilisation auprès du personnel 2) l'évaluation de l'état de santé bucco-dentaire des résidents 3) des ateliers de démonstration individualisée des techniques d'hygiène impliquant le personnel et les résidents. Ce travail décrit et évalue l'impact du projet SOA. Vingt-six chirurgiens-dentistes ont participé au projet dans sa totalité. A l'issue de leur formation en ligne, une augmentation significative de leur sentiment de compétence pour 16 aptitudes spécifiques a été observée. Une amélioration du contrôle de plaque a été notée pour 33,7% des résidents (n=691). Une amélioration des habitudes d'hygiène bucco-dentaire au sein des établissements a été observée pour 11,5% des résidents (n=814). Cette étude est la première à montrer l'impact relativement faible de ce type d'action et incite leur association à d'autres dispositifs de promotion de la santé orale.

Book excerpt: Earthen architecture constitutes one of the most diverse forms of cultural heritage and one of the most challenging to preserve. It dates from all periods and is found on all continents but is particularly prevalent in Africa, where it has been a building tradition for centuries. Sites range from ancestral cities in Mali to the palaces of Abomey in Benin, from monuments and mosques in Iran and Buddhist temples on the Silk Road to Spanish missions in California. This volume's sixty-four papers address such themes as earthen architecture in Mali, the conservation of living sites, local knowledge systems and intangible aspects, seismic and other natural forces, the conservation and management of archaeological sites, research advances, and training.

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: Over the 20th century, Morocco has become one of the world’s major emigration countries. But since 2000, growing immigration and settlement of migrants from sub-Saharan Africa, the Middle East, and Europe confronts Morocco with an entirely new set of social, cultural, political and legal issues. This book explores how continued emigration and increasing immigration is transforming contemporary Moroccan society, with a particular emphasis on the way the Moroccan state is dealing with shifting migratory realities. The authors of this collective volume embark on a dialogue between theory and empirical research, showcasing how contemporary migration theories help understanding recent trends in Moroccan migration, and, vice-versa, how the specific Moroccan case enriches migration theory. This perspective helps to overcome the still predominant Western-centric research view that artificially divide the world into ‘receiving’ and ‘sending’ countries and largely disregards the dynamics of and experiences with migration in countries in the Global South. Book excerpt: Margaret Mead collaborated with her long-time colleague Rhoda Métraux in this unique study of French culture. The Hoover Institute at Stanford University originally published this volume, which grew out of the Columbia University project on Research of Contemporary Cultures in 1954. It is one of the few works by American social scientists dealing with broad themes of French life. Mead and Métraux present a vivid picture of the French starting with the organization of the house and its architecture, and drawing original conclusions for the structure of French families and overall cultural values. This work, long out of print, is a fascinating and penetrating portrait of a contemporary European society.

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: In recent years organic sulfur chemistry has been growing at an even faster pace than the very rapid development in other fields of chemistry. This phenomenal growth is undoubtedly a reflection of industrial and public demands: not only was sulfur recently in overall surplus for the first time in the history of the chemical industry but it has now become a prin cipal environmental hazard in the form of sulfur dioxide, sulfuric acid and hydrogen sulfide. Another reason, discernible in the last fifteen years, has been the desire, on the part of individual chemists and all types of research managers, to move away from the established chemistry of carbon into the less well understood and sometimes virgin chemistries of the other elements which form covalent bonds. As a result of this movement the last decade has seen the development of sulfur chemistry into a well-organized and now much better understood branch of organic chemistry. Enough of the detail has become clear to see mechanistic interrelationships between previously unconnected reactions and with this clarification the whole subject has in tum become systema tized and subdivided. The divalent sulfur chemistry of thiols, monosulfides, disulfides and polysulfides is a large area in itself, much of it devoted to oxidation-reduction and the breakage and formation of sulfur-sulfur bonds, although interesting discoveries are now being made about the reac tivity of certain sulfur-carbon bonds. Of course, this area has its own mas sive biochemical branch involving enzymes and proteins.
